Sal is the NPC quest provider in the Back Alley area of Storage Hunters: Open World. Unlocked at 750 net worth, Sal offers a quest chain that introduces you to mid-level containers, more valuable items, and the Back Alley gameplay experience. Completing Sal's quests rewards you with the Cowboy Hat accessory and a substantial amount of cash to fuel your continued progression. Meeting Sal: Back Alley Introduction
Sal is located in the Back Alley area, which unlocks when your net worth reaches 750 cash. When you first enter the Back Alley, Sal will be standing near the entrance, ready to introduce you to the area and offer his quest chain. Talk to Sal by approaching him and pressing the interact button.
Who Is Sal?
Sal is a seasoned Back Alley dealer who knows the value of everything that comes through the area's containers. He is more experienced than Billy from the Junk Yard and offers tougher quests with better rewards. Sal's dialogue reflects his street-smart personality, and he provides useful tips about Back Alley container types and item values.

Sal's Complete Quest Chain
Sal's quest chain consists of 4-5 quests that must be completed in order. Each quest builds on the previous one, progressively introducing you to deeper Back Alley mechanics.
Quest 1: Back Alley Introduction
| Attribute | Detail |
|---|---|
| Quest Name | Back Alley Introduction |
| Objective | Win a Back Alley container auction |
| Cash Reward | 500 cash |
| Item Reward | None |
| Difficulty | Easy |
Walkthrough:
- Talk to Sal to accept the quest
- Look for an available Back Alley container on the auction board
- Bid on the container and win the auction
- The quest completes automatically when you win any Back Alley container
Tips:
- Back Alley containers are more expensive than Junk Yard containers. Make sure you have at least 1,000 cash before starting.
- The Back Alley introduces you to the Storage Locker and Tool Chest container types. See our All Containers Guide for details.
- Do not overspend on this first auction. A modest bid is sufficient to complete the quest.
Quest 2: The Good Stuff
| Attribute | Detail |
|---|---|
| Quest Name | The Good Stuff |
| Objective | Find 3 items worth 1,000+ cash each |
| Cash Reward | 1,000 cash |
| Item Reward | None |
| Difficulty | Moderate |
Walkthrough:
- Sal asks you to find valuable items in Back Alley containers
- Bid on containers and loot items worth 1,000+ cash each
- You need to find 3 separate items that meet the value threshold
- The quest tracks automatically as you loot qualifying items
Tips:
- Focus on Storage Lockers, which tend to contain more valuable items than Tool Chests
- Check item values before leaving the container area. The value is displayed when you pick up each item
- Mutated items count toward the quest if their mutated value exceeds 1,000 cash. A Gold mutation (4x) on a 300 cash item becomes 1,200 cash and qualifies. See our Gold Mutation Guide for mutation details.
Quest 3: Sal's Special Request
| Attribute | Detail |
|---|---|
| Quest Name | Sal's Special Request |
| Objective | Find and deliver a specific rare item to Sal |
| Cash Reward | 2,000 cash |
| Item Reward | None |
| Difficulty | Moderate |
Walkthrough:
- Sal requests a specific rare item that can be found in Back Alley containers
- The requested item changes each playthrough (it is randomized from a pool of mid-tier items)
- Bid on containers until you find the specific item Sal wants
- Deliver the item to Sal by talking to him with the item in your inventory
- Sal takes the item and rewards you with 2,000 cash
Tips:
- The requested item is always something that can be found in Back Alley containers. You do not need to go to other areas.
- If you already have the item in your inventory from previous auctions, you can deliver it immediately
- The item you give to Sal is consumed. If it is particularly valuable, weigh the 2,000 cash reward against the item's sell value. If the item sells for more than 2,000 cash, consider selling it instead and finding a cheaper version
Quest 4: Alley Veteran
| Attribute | Detail |
|---|---|
| Quest Name | Alley Veteran |
| Objective | Complete 10 Back Alley auctions |
| Cash Reward | 3,000 cash + Cowboy Hat |
| Difficulty | Moderate |
Walkthrough:
- Sal challenges you to become a Back Alley regular
- Win 10 container auctions in the Back Alley
- The quest tracks your cumulative Back Alley auction wins
- Upon completing 10 wins, return to Sal for the Cowboy Hat and 3,000 cash
Tips:
- This is a cumulative quest. Previous Back Alley auction wins count toward the total
- If you have been bidding in the Back Alley since unlocking it, you may already have several wins counted
- Focus on cheaper Back Alley containers (Tool Chests) if cash is tight. You only need to win the auction, not necessarily make a profit on each one
- The Cowboy Hat is an Uncommon head accessory required for the full accessory collection. See our All Accessories Guide for the complete list
Quest 5: Back Alley Boss (Optional/Advanced)
| Attribute | Detail |
|---|---|
| Quest Name | Back Alley Boss |
| Objective | Reach 5,000 cash net worth |
| Cash Reward | 5,000 cash |
| Item Reward | None |
| Difficulty | Moderate |
Walkthrough:
- After completing the Alley Veteran quest, Sal offers one final challenge
- Reach a net worth of 5,000 cash
- Your net worth is calculated from your total cash plus the value of items in your shop
- Return to Sal once you reach the milestone
Tips:
- This quest naturally completes as you progress toward the Farmyard area
- Net worth includes cash in your wallet and items on your shop shelves
- Selling high-value items quickly boosts your net worth. Use strategies from our How to Get Rich Fast Guide
- The 5,000 cash reward is a nice bonus on top of the milestone you were already working toward
Sal's Quest Rewards Summary
| Quest | Cash Reward | Item Reward | Cumulative Cash |
|---|---|---|---|
| Back Alley Introduction | 500 cash | None | 500 cash |
| The Good Stuff | 1,000 cash | None | 1,500 cash |
| Sal's Special Request | 2,000 cash | None | 3,500 cash |
| Alley Veteran | 3,000 cash | Cowboy Hat | 6,500 cash |
| Back Alley Boss | 5,000 cash | None | 11,500 cash |
Completing all of Sal's quests nets you approximately 11,500 cash and the Cowboy Hat accessory. This is a significant boost that accelerates your progression toward the Farmyard.

Frequently Asked Questions
Where is Sal located? Sal is in the Back Alley area, which unlocks at 750 net worth. He stands near the entrance of the Back Alley.
What accessory does Sal give? Sal rewards the Cowboy Hat accessory upon completing the Alley Veteran quest (10 Back Alley auctions won).
Do I need to complete Sal's quests to progress? No, area progression is based on net worth, not quest completion. However, Sal's quests provide significant cash rewards that accelerate your progression, and the Cowboy Hat is required for the full accessory collection.
How long does Sal's quest chain take? For an active player, Sal's entire quest chain can be completed in 1-2 hours. The Alley Veteran quest (10 auction wins) is the longest individual quest.
Can I repeat Sal's quests? No, NPC quests are one-time completions. Once you finish Sal's quest chain, the quests are permanently completed.
